Varonis Systems, Inc. (BIT:1VRNS)
Italy flag Italy · Delayed Price · Currency is EUR
49.05
0.00 (0.00%)
At close: Oct 10, 2025

Varonis Systems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202012 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2012 - 2019
5,9244,3034,2512,2184,5134,480
Upgrade
Market Cap Growth
3.11%1.22%91.65%-50.85%0.73%119.09%
Upgrade
Enterprise Value
5,5654,4544,0521,8524,0714,459
Upgrade
PE Ratio
--51.66-49.22-21.00-43.95-54.54
Upgrade
Forward PE
258.20154.00131.97110.89--
Upgrade
PS Ratio
11.699.089.905.4413.4417.79
Upgrade
PB Ratio
20.3710.9710.095.138.7955.34
Upgrade
P/TBV Ratio
16.1410.8910.095.218.6154.69
Upgrade
P/FCF Ratio
55.7546.0990.955426.72-1583.42-326.24
Upgrade
P/OCF Ratio
51.1243.4183.15217.14730.61-891.17
Upgrade
EV/Sales Ratio
10.879.399.434.5412.1317.70
Upgrade
EV/EBITDA Ratio
--99.28-89.77-36.05-64.22-93.96
Upgrade
EV/EBIT Ratio
--43.99-40.17-17.75-47.93-66.07
Upgrade
EV/FCF Ratio
52.3647.7086.684530.09-1428.35-324.66
Upgrade
Debt / Equity Ratio
2.171.630.620.610.492.90
Upgrade
Debt / EBITDA Ratio
-13.43-14.26-5.75-5.14-3.99-4.95
Upgrade
Debt / FCF Ratio
5.956.855.56645.45-88.77-17.11
Upgrade
Asset Turnover
0.360.400.460.440.470.67
Upgrade
Quick Ratio
1.241.072.293.804.372.15
Upgrade
Current Ratio
1.381.242.503.964.532.30
Upgrade
Return on Equity (ROE)
-17.70%-14.86%-14.70%-17.68%-30.35%-82.93%
Upgrade
Return on Assets (ROA)
-6.03%-7.19%-9.16%-9.87%-11.22%-16.25%
Upgrade
Return on Capital (ROIC)
-8.08%-10.80%-25.66%-42.31%-38.27%-32.75%
Upgrade
Return on Capital Employed (ROCE)
-13.52%-13.43%-14.54%-14.16%-15.55%-29.50%
Upgrade
Earnings Yield
-1.48%-1.94%-2.03%-4.76%-2.28%-1.83%
Upgrade
FCF Yield
1.79%2.17%1.10%0.02%-0.06%-0.31%
Upgrade
Buyback Yield / Dilution
0.52%0.44%1.08%2.93%-9.73%-0.19%
Upgrade
Total Shareholder Return
-0.44%1.08%2.93%-9.73%-0.19%
Upgrade
Updated Jun 30, 2025. Data Source: Fiscal.ai. Standard template. Financial Sources.